The Role

The Cleaner in Charge is responsible for overseeing the opening and closing of the school and performing various internal and external cleaning duties.This includes maintaining carpets and hard floor surfaces, cleaning toilets, furniture, and fittings, dusting, window cleaning, rubbish removal, and other general cleaning tasks.

Externally, the role involves cleaning verandas, covered areas, and drinking troughs, removing cobwebs, and performing general upkeep of the grounds.The Cleaner in Charge will also oversee vacation cleaning tasks such as stripping and sealing vinyl floors, shampooing carpets, pressure cleaning verandas and undercover areas, and other related duties.

In addition to cleaning responsibilities, the suitable applicants will ideally have experience in supervising staff. They should manage and work alongside school staff, ensuring optimal performance in consultation with the Manager of Corporate Services.

The Cleaner in Charge will maintain the cleaner’s time book, arrange for relief staff when necessary, monitor and order cleaning supplies, conduct regular stocktakes and manage equipment maintenance and replacement.

Eligibility

To work with us, you will need to: 

  • obtain a valid Working With Children Check.  
  • consent to a Nationally Coordinated Criminal History Check and obtain a current Screening Clearance Number issued by the Department of Education’s Screening Unit before you start.
  • be an Australian or New Zealand citizen, permanent resident or have a valid visa with relevant work rights for the term of the appointment.
